This beautiful pair is part of the Flora Danica jewellery range designed by Orla Eggert and first released in 1953 in Copenhagen. The earrings would date to around 1970.

The Flora Danica range of jewellery took real pieces of botanical sprigs which were dipped in sterling silver and then in 22 carat gold. Each is unique and the design varies slightly.

The earrings have a post and butterfly keepers. One keeper is stamped 925S, the other has no markings. There is no marking to the earrings themselves.

There is no damage and no wear to the gold. There is tarnish to the recesses of the design.

The earrings are around 15mm across.
